Diwali is all about glitter and shine. It is considered auspicious to buy gold and silver on Dhanteras. So, why not invest in some silver jewellery this year? These exquisite pieces will be your life-long assets and you can customised them later as well. My Kolkata lists some of the silver pieces you must have in your collection.

Ear studs

If you are buying silver for the first time, invest in these dainty studs. They are not only stylish, but are also affordable. You can pair these up with your ethnic, casual, office wear or lounge wears. Most of these studs come encrusted with semi-precious stones, like emeralds, pearls and rubies — just perfect for the free-spirited woman of today.

Earrings

Earrings are a must in your collection. If you are a jhumka lover, the idea would be to save enough to find pieces within your budget. You can also opt for brands that offer EMI services. These earrings can be paired with any attire. Just chuck the necklace if you are wearing big earrings.

Nosepins

If you have nose piercing, then it is always good to wear a silver or gold nosepin rather than an imitation one. Purchasing a delicate silver nosepin is always worth the money. They go well with all kinds of outfits and highlight your facial features as well. You also get nosepins studded with semi-precious stones. Those who do not have a piercing, can always look for false ones.

Finger rings

Pick ornaments that are intrinsically hand-crafted using natural stones. If you are a ring lover, you must buy one for yourself this festive season. From singular, bold rings to ones studded with stones or mother of pearl inlays — they come in various shapes and designs.

Necklaces

Want to make heads turn this Diwali? Look for chunky necklaces that’ll give you the right look and do not demand any more accessories to go with it. Put on your best dress, apply light makeup, wear the necklace and you are ready to go.

Mangalsutra

Those who are married, why not opt for a silver mangalsutra this season? Silver is light on the skin and much recommended as daily wear. The pendants come in different shapes and sizes and will make you stand out in the crowd.

Bangles

Opt for simple bangles, kadas or stone-studded silver ratanchurs. You can team up a bulky kada with a western outfit or try a combination of light to thick bangles to go with your lehengas or saris. And those who want to try something different, can pair a ratanchur with an indo-western outfit.

Bracelets

A wristlet is a hot favorite among those who like to keep it minimal. You can get your own evil-eye bracelet. It is believed to exude positive energy around you.

Maang Tika

Remember the maang tika worn by Aishwarya Rai in Jodhaa Akbar? Now you can get one for yourself too. Maang tika adds to your facial charm. Pair it with lighter earrings or choose not to wear earrings at all. You can tie your hair in a bun or back brush and let it loose at the back.

Anklets

If you are a payal lover, opt for a silver one, which would be long-lasting and comfortable as well. Anklets can often be customised as per your likings. You can also consider a pair of heavy payals to wear during festivals.
